Service Information

Quick View:
  • Accessible (ramp or elevator, large print bulletins, hearing assist devices)
  • Church pick-up service as needed (call office if needed)
  • Inclusive language, recognizing the deeply personal words we use to address God
  • Biblically grounded, socially relevant preaching
  • Excellent music
  • No dress code
More Detail:

Worship Services at First UMC are conducted on Sunday mornings at 8:30 A.M. and 11:00 A.M. from the Sunday after Labor Day thru mid June. The later service moves to 10:00 A.M. from mid June through Labor Day. We strive to enable each worshiper to experience an encounter with the living God. Our early service is conducted in the Embury Room (lounge area adjacent to the main sanctuary), with piano support. This service is more informal in approach.

Our later service is conducted in the sanctuary with the support of our magnificent pipe organ.

All of our services employ music, liturgy, symbols, movement, quiet time, and preaching appropriate to themes and seasons. We employ a wide-variety of cultural, ethnic, and liturgical traditions. One or more of our three vocal choirs, our three hand bell choirs, or occasional instrumental ensembles will contribute to the worship experience. Our new liturgical dance troupe also participates.

Holy Communion is celebrated on the first Sunday of each month, or the first Sunday of a new season in the Church Year (Advent, Christmas, Epiphany, Lent, Easter and Pentecost), as well as at other times. Baptisms are scheduled with the Pastor through the church office (see Baptism link).

Our preaching is biblically based and socially relevant. It is also presently connected to our Sunday School curriculum Seasons of the Spirit which is based on the Revised Common Lectionary (a proscribed set of scriptural texts for the church year).

There is no dress code! Dress in whatever way is comfortable and natural for you.
